SoftBank's $10B Margin Loan on OpenAI Shares: High Stakes or Smart Move?
SoftBank's ambitious plan to secure a $10 billion margin loan against their OpenAI shares aims at AI expansion without asset sales. With a 13% stake in OpenAI and $64.6 billion invested, they're leveraging OpenAI's high valuation to raise capital. This move aligns with their aggressive AI investment strategy. But risks loom if OpenAI's value drops.

Elon Musk Taps Intel's 14A Tech for SpaceX-Managed TeraFab AI Chips
Elon Musk's TeraFab project plans to adopt Intel's 14A process technology for AI chip production, with SpaceX handling high-volume manufacturing. This $20B initiative aims to centralize chip fabrication, memory, and packaging all in one facility — a significant move for U.S. semiconductor independence.
